The Next Morning
Gilbert arrived early. He was a big, burly man with long hair and a big, bushy beard. He looked like someone who came out of the mountains. It was obvious through how him and Doc were chest to chest talking tough to one another that they were old friends and it was a good thing as Gilbert dwarfed Doc! When they were finished, they hugged and he turned his attention to the young lady nearby.
"Ye' must be Sonja," he said to her kindly with his odd accent. "A friend the' ol' Doc here is a friend o' mine. Gilbert Malloy at ye' su'vice!" He gently took her hand his huge hand and gave a gentle shake.
"Make damn sure ol' Doc here takes care o' ye' or I shall kick his ass meself!" he told her.
"In your dreams, you old Junker," he replied to him.
"Fear not, Doc," he said to him, "ye' place will be fine in me care."
Within minutes, they boarded a shuttle in a nearby field that Gilbert had arrived in with the clothing they needed. Sonja had her pick of the old wardrobe left behind by his late wife and he himself took enough for a couple of days plus his medical bag. The shuttle left the ground and headed for an atmospheric point on the backside of the planet. It was there that it docked with a much larger ship, a Junker tagged cargo ship headed to an undisclosed location.
"Take care o' my friends," Gilbert told the captain. "You will find a shipment o' arms in the hold o' your other ship and a generous overpayment for ye' help."
When Gilbert left, the trip began.
They travelled through New York and California with no problem. Cortez was busy with some Bretonian military ships in the region but an empty Junker freighter was of no concern to them. In Manchester, only a Hacker patrol stopped them briefly but let them be. Why shouldn't they? Junkers and Hackers did business quite often. New London and Leeds were uneventful as they continued through Tau 31, Tau 29 and finally Bafffin. The only real incident were some bounty hunters around Freeport 6. They were disappointed to find the ship empty. Junkers and hunters had no love of each other but they left each other alone with no good reason to cause a ruckus.
By the time they arrived at "Med Force General and Research" in Baffin, Doc was finally awoken to give clearance codes for docking. He had been sleeping since Cortez. Upon docking, a large shipment of arms was awaiting the Junker ship as promised. As a personal thank you, Doc heavily tipped the captain.
"If ever you need medical help, come see us," Doc told him with a hand shake. Within minutes, the now full transport left for wherever.
The day was one of travel and was long. Even though he slept through most of the trip, he was tired and he was certain that Sonja was as well. He then escorted Sonja and Niki to her quarters as a security guard carried her baggage to the door. Doc thanked him and dismissed him.
"Tomorrow morning we begin," he explained to her. He then handed her a com badge.
"I will be in my quarters if you need me."
With that he took his leave of her for the evening.
